Understanding Long Distance Moves

What Makes up a Long Distance Move?

When we talk about long-distance steps, we're typically describing relocations that exceed 100 miles. Unlike regional relocations, which are often straightforward, long-distance moving requires mindful planning and consideration of various elements.

Organizing Your Belongings

Decide what products are worth bringing along versus what can be offered or donated.

Tips for Decluttering Before You Move

    Use the "one-year regulation"-- if you haven't used it in a year, think about allowing it go. Host a yard sale or donate products to local charities.

   Frequently Asked Questions Concerning Long Distance Moves

   FAQ # 1: How do I choose a trustworthy long distance moving company?

Research evaluates online and ask close friends for recommendations while getting quotes from numerous sources.

   FAQ # 2: What ought to I perform with my pets during the move?

Consider boarding them briefly or maintaining them in separate rooms away from busy locations up until unpacked.

   FAQ # 3: Can I load my own things when working with movers?

Yes! The majority of firms permit you to load individual valuables; just clarify any plans concerning liability.

  FAQ # 4: Just how should I prepare my home appliances for transport?

Ensure all home appliances are cleared out and separated; consult guidebooks if required for correct disassembly.

#   FAQ # 6: Exactly how much in advance needs to I reserve my move?

It's recommended to publication at least 6 weeks in advance during peak seasons (summer months).
